A heads up today for anyone with an Access Card. They are currently running a 1-1 ratio due to complaints to Nimbus regarding how busy queues have been etc.
I’m not sure if it’s as a result of more people with Access Cards, such as the current Merlin problem, or an increase in Fast Pass sales. There was defiantly more people in the access/fast pass queues than I’ve ever seen today, but not sure how related that is to the run Drayton Manor event.
Something to keep an eye on if you’re visiting with 2 kids for example.
